MGM is a French company
founded 41 years ago,
specialized in the sector Promotion immobilière de logements.
Based in EPAGNY METZ-TESSY (74330),
this company of category ETI
shows in 2024 a revenue of 9.4 M€.
Find below the complete financial statements, solvency ratios, working capital requirements and sector comparison.
In 2024, MGM achieves revenue of 9.4 M€. Activity remains stable over the period (CAGR: -1.8%). Significant drop of -58% vs 2023. After deducting consumption (1.2 M€), gross margin stands at 8.2 M€, i.e. a rate of 87%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 768 k€, representing 8.2% of revenue. This level of operating margin is satisfactory for the sector.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 4.5 M€, i.e. 47.6%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 7%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 87%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 10.6 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. Beyond 7 years, banks generally consider credit risk as high. Cash flow represents 4.7%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 55 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 60 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 5 days. Inventory turnover is 273 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). This high level ties up cash and potentially creates obsolescence risk. Overall, WCR represents 2517 days of revenue, i.e. 65.5 M€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2024, WCR increased by +21%, requiring additional financing.
